I receive feedback through my headphones, but it's only when my iPad is charging. It also only occurs when I'm not touching it. I noticed the buzzing sound while my ipad was plugged in and Netflix was loading. I could only stop the humming by either touching the iPad or unplugging it.

Anyone else experience this?
 
Is it plugged into your computer to charge? If you can do it that way it might get rid of the noise. If you are charging it off your computer, then try using the wall charger, it might get rid of the noise.

Either way it is caused from bad wiring in your house. It's pretty common actually, and it is recommended that you buy a line conditioner to solve the problem. Most UPS come with this built in, but some surge protectors also have this feature.

Note that this is a good thing to get for all your audio equipment anyway. Pretty worthy investment if you care about sound quality at all.
